All You Can Eat Vegan Pizza! - Salt Meats Cheese, Broadway

Establishment: Salt Meats Cheese, Broadway
Cuisine: Family owned Italian Restaurant
Allergy information: Vegan Pizza Night has many dairy, egg, nut and seafood free options
Suggestions: Potatoes Pizza! And the Truffle and Mushroom.

Then a couple of my friends brought the new All You Can Eat Vegan Pizza Tuesdays at Salt Meats Cheese in Broadway to my attention. It took a little while before I was able to coordinate a dinner with my friend, Colleen, but we finally made our way there to give the pizzas a try. 

To get in on All You Can Eat Vegan Pizza Tuesdays, they do recommend you book ahead so Col booked online and we were all set. The cost is just $20 with any drinks purchase so we made our way in and ordered drinks and first pizzas. I couldn't not order the Potatoes Pizza first because anything potato is absolutely my kind of food, while Col went for the Truffle and Mushroom.

And this time around, not only was the Notzarella really delicious and perfectly paired with the potato, rosemary and garlic, I didn't experience any form of reaction - no tickle, no itch. Fantastic! Above were the other options available, the Vegetariana stood out in particular and might have been consumed were it not for our very full bellies. Saying that, that was a great selection to choose from and a lot more allergy-friendly options than I'd ever seen before on one menu.

If you're looking for some beautiful gourmet pizza for a genuinely reasonable price, I would highly recommend giving All You Can Eat Vegan Tuesdays a go! They do advise booking beforehand but they will also try to seat you as best as they can if you don't. I would be sure to flag any allergies with staff or send any queries to them beforehand so they're aware and hopefully you get to enjoy a full Tuesday eve of some fantastic pizza!
